Do I need previous experience?
Not at all. You do not need any previous canyoning experience to join us. What matters far more are three simple things: a basic ability to swim, feeling comfortable in water, and a moderate level of fitness. If you can manage a steady walk, enjoy splashing about and don't panic when you're out of your depth, you already have what it takes.
Every jump along the way is entirely optional, and every obstacle has an easier alternative. That means first-timers are never pushed beyond their comfort zone. If a leap into a pool looks too bold, there's always a gentler way down — and our guides will show you exactly where it is.

Which canyon should beginners choose?
For families and first-timers, we especially recommend our Grabovica canyon. It's shorter, wide and sunny, with plenty of gentle natural pools to ease into — a relaxed, welcoming introduction to the sport. Do note that Grabovica runs only during the spring season, when the water levels are just right. Our Nevidio canyon is the bigger, more adventurous day out, yet it remains accessible to fit beginners who are happy to push themselves a little further.
What about the gear and the cold?
We provide everything you need: a 5 mm wetsuit, neoprene socks, canyon shoes, a helmet and a harness. The mountain water is genuinely cold — around 10°C — but the wetsuit keeps you warm and snug, and most people quickly forget the chill once the fun begins.
